Job Description

What You’ll Be Doing

You will develop new client relationships through business development activities, actively monitor and manage the relationship with the client, and structure, negotiate and document credit and cash management arrangements to deliver what matters to our clients and help them realize their goals. As a Manager, Commercial Banking, you will join CIBC to manage and grow a portfolio of agriculture & commercial banking clients by proactively developing new business opportunities in the community and ensuring clients’ day-to-day banking needs are being met at the highest level.

How You’ll Succeed

  • Relationship Building – Develop new client relationships through business development activities leveraging referral sources, existing clients and centres of influence. Actively monitor and manage these relationships by fully understanding our client’s goals, objectives and status of our clients business.
  • Provide Solutions – Proactively assess client needs and propose solutions to deliver what matters to our clients by structuring, negotiating and documenting credit and cash management arrangements with clients and prospects that meet client needs.
  • Collaborate – Work with internal partners to connect clients with opportunities and commit to building a profile in the local business community in order to leverage that profile into effective working relationships with new and existing clients and internal partners.

Who You Are

  • You can demonstrate experience in agriculture, commercial or business banking, proven business development skills, and a solid understanding of financial statements and account principles including valuation techniques and cash flow analysis.
  • You have an established profile in the local agriculture or business community. You have knowledge of a diverse marketplace and needs of local businesses.
  • You have a degree in Business, Finance, Agribusiness, Accounting, or a related field.
  • You put our clients first. You have well-developed client and relationship management skills. You engage with purpose to find the right solutions.
